Beautifully presented Grade II listed cottage with exquisite gardens, in a popular village

With distinctive gables, stone elevations, fish-scale tiled roofs and diamond leaded windows, Walliscote Cottage is a quintessential, period property offering a home with a wealth of character exquisitely combined with contemporary styling to suit modern lifestyles. Rustic black and terracotta, geometric floor tiling and half-panelled walls feature in the reception hall, which leads through to the drawing room offering a fireplace and a crafted seat within the bay window. Further relaxed seating can be enjoyed in the family room, which has glazed, double doors opening onto a garden terrace providing the ideal inside to outside living environment. Adjoining is an impressive kitchen/breakfast room which features bespoke cabinetry and integrated appliances including a Britiannia cooker with three ovens and five ring gas hob, a Stoves dishwasher and a Caple wine fridge. Work surfaces are quartz with an inset circular, wood breakfast bar setting, along with ample space for dining. A utility with integrated washer/tumble dryer, incorporating a cloakroom, complements the kitchen, and a study with fitted cupboards provides the perfect hide-away for home-workers. On the first floor, there are four bedrooms and a well-appointed shower room. The principal room has fitted wardrobe storage and a step level change to access a stylish en suite bathroom which features a twin sink stand in wood and a bath-tub with waterfall shower over

Situation

Whitchurch on Thames is a picturesque and highly sought-after Thameside village in an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. An easy, early morning walk allows commuters to access Pangbourne mainline station for journeys to London Paddington, with the village also offering day-to-day amenities, cafés and restaurants. The more comprehensive amenities of Reading are 7 miles away (London, Paddington 27 mins) and the M4 (J12) is within easy reach providing vehicular access to London, its airports and the motorway network. The local area is served by well-regarded schooling, including Whitchurch Primary school (Ofsted Outstanding), The Oratory Prep and Senior schools, Pangbourne College, St Andrews Prep and Cranford House. There are recreational facilities for all requirements in the locality including the fitness and tennis centre at Bradfield College and for golf-enthusiasts courses can be found at Streatley Hills, Mapledurham and Calcot.
